![]() So I had to order from eBay some new SAW tooth resonator that operate on 433.42MHz.Īfter I got those, I just replaces the resonator on the module with the new. I had some 433 RF modules in my drawer but those are operating at 433.92 MHz ![]() So after some google-ing I found a great guy called Nickduino on Github and he wrote an Arduino sketch that emulates Somfy remote.Īnd the Somfy RTS protocol is explained here.īut in a nutshell, the remote is operating at 433.42 MHz and the modulation is ASK/OOK.
